LAHORE: Pakistan five-a-side Hockey coach Olympian Rehan Butt claimed that the team is focusing more on their clash against the arch-rival India in the upcoming tournament, scheduled to be held in Switzerland.
Rehan, in a statement, ahead of the team’s departure for Switzerland to participate in the tournament, claimed that Malaysia and India are going to give tough times to the Green Shirts while the side has a sharp focus on their faceoff with the arch-rivals.
“Malaysia and India will give us a tough time in the event but we are focusing more on the match against India,” Rehan shared.
“Everyone enjoys the match between Pakistan and India, we will try our best to play well and win against them,” he added
Talking about the team’s preparation for the event Rehan claimed that his team was fully prepared for the new format of the game.
“We have prepared well for the new format, fitness has been the major emphasis,” he stated. “I am fully satisfied with the fitness and skills of the players and we hope to play well.”
Pakistan’s five-a-side hockey team will be departing tomorrow to participate in the event which will be held in Switzerland.
